Pork Chops with Parmesan Sauce

Are you looking for a simple meat dish that only takes 20 minutes to prepare and no special ingredients?  Look to Pork Chops with Parmesean Sauce.  This main dish can be made in less than 20 minutes and you likely already have all the ingredients in your refrigerator.  The flavors are simple so even picky eaters won't complain.


Pork Chops with Parmesan Sauce
Serves 4
 
4 boneless pork chops
Salt and pepper
1 tablespoon butter
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 cup skim milk
1/3 cup grated Parmesan cheese
2 tablespoons minced onion
3 teaspoons chopped fresh parsley
1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g

Season pork chops with salt and pepper. In a large nonstick grill pan, melt butter.  Add pork chops and cook over medium heat until meat juices run clear and internal temperature reaches 160 degrees.  Remove and keep warm.
Combine flour and milk until smooth; stir into pan. Bring to a boil; cook and whisk for 2 minutes or until thickened. Stir in remaining ingredients; heat through. Serve with chops.
